Price Range Overview
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$3,500 - $7,000 (lar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Single Wood Window Replacement |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Full Window Frame Replacement | $2,500 - $6,000 |
| Custom Wood Window Installation | $4,000 - $8,500 |
| Historic Window Restoration | $3,500 - $7,000 |
| Multiple Window Replacement | $8,000 - $20,000 |
| Bay or Bow Window Installation | $5,000 - $12,000 |
Factors Affecting Price
Wood window installation projects in Monroe, CT, typically involve selecting appropriate materials, assessing window sizes, and navigating local permitting processes. Understanding the scope and requirements can help in planning and budgeting for a successful installation.
- Materials: Commonly used materials include solid wood, wood-clad options, and composite woods,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from replacing a single window to multiple units across a property, with sizes varying based on architectural styles and preferences.
- Labor Complexity: Installation complexity depends on existing window conditions, wall construction, and custom fitting needs, influencing labor time and effort.
- Permitting: Local permits may be required in Monroe, CT, especially for larger or structural modifications, and should be obtained prior to starting work.
- Extras: Additional features such as custom hardware, energy-efficient glass, or decorative trim can affect overall project costs and timelines.
